I am trying to debug a third-party flash movie (so I don't have direct
access to the code, but I can ask them to add small snippets).  What I
would like to be able to do is to trace the name of a function/method
and the arguments it is passed upon invocation of that function.  I
need to be able to do that in a non-intrusive and generic way.

Wondering what people's thoughts are on this.  I can see a couple of
potential ways this could be done: one, override some internal
function that is used to make function calls; two, use a function like
__resolve() that would get called when any defined function is
invoked.  Anybody know if such things exist?  Or if there is some
other, simpler way which I'm missing?
